Lakhimpur Girls College, established in 2014 and affiliated to Dibrugarh University, is a public institute located in North Lakhimpur, Assam. The college offers undergraduate programs in Arts, Science, and Education, with a typical intake of ~285 seats for its flagship B.A. program. Admission is primarily merit-based, relying on scores from CBSE 12th or AHSEC examinations. The usual application window falls between April–June each year, and total fees for UG programs generally range from INR 6,000–9,000 per year. Hostel accommodation is available for girls, allotted strictly on a merit basis.

Lakhimpur Girls College Admission Deadlines

Lakhimpur Girls College typically opens its admission portal for undergraduate applications in April and closes by June annually, with merit lists published in late June. Counseling and document verification are conducted in July, and classes commence in August. For postgraduate programs, admissions usually follow the Dibrugarh University schedule, with applications accepted in June–July and classes starting in August. The application fee for UG and PG programs is approximately INR 250–400, payable online.

 

Lakhimpur Girls College UG Admission

The undergraduate admissions at Lakhimpur Girls College for 2025 are offered in Arts, Science, and Education streams, with the most popular being the B.A. (6 semesters, 3 years). Applicants must have passed the CBSE 12th or AHSEC exam, with a minimum eligibility of 40–50% marks depending on stream. The annual fee for UG programs is typically INR 6,000–9,000. There are ~285 seats for B.A., and reservation policies as per Dibrugarh University and Assam Government are followed. Hostel seats for girls are allotted based on merit.

 

Lakhimpur Girls College PG Admission

Lakhimpur Girls College offers limited postgraduate options, typically in Arts and select Science subjects, with admissions based on merit in the qualifying bachelor's degree. The minimum eligibility is a Bachelor’s degree with 50% marks from a recognized university. PG admissions usually open in June–July, with annual fees in the range of INR 8,000–12,000. Intake varies by program and is subject to Dibrugarh University norms. Reservation and scholarships are available as per government guidelines.

 

Lakhimpur Girls College PhD Admission

PhD admissions at Lakhimpur Girls College are conducted in collaboration with Dibrugarh University, primarily in Arts and Science disciplines. Applicants must hold a Master’s degree with 55% marks (or equivalent) and qualify through the Dibrugarh University PhD Entrance Test (DUPET) or UGC-NET. Applications are accepted once annually, typically in July–August. The fee structure for PhD programs is approximately INR 15,000–18,000 per year, with seat availability subject to departmental capacity and supervisor availability.

 

Lakhimpur Girls College Application Process

Applications to Lakhimpur Girls College are accepted online via the official college portal during the notified window. Candidates must upload scanned copies of required documents, including 10th and 12th mark sheets, identity proof, photographs, and category certificates if applicable. The application fee of INR 250–400 is payable online. Merit lists are published on the college website, and shortlisted candidates must attend counseling with originals and photocopies for verification. Hostel seats are allotted post-admission, based on merit.

  • Register on the official college admission portal during April–June.

  • Fill the online application form and upload scanned documents (max 5 MB each).

  • Pay the application fee online (INR 250–400).

  • Check merit list publication and attend counseling on designated dates.

  • Submit originals and photocopies for document verification.
